OK, these are some of the moments between Edge and Rydia that I have compiled from FFIV The After Years. Some people haven't played the game, so I warn you that this is FULL of spoilers.

These are the moments only, but not the full story, just a simplified version - and not in proper order.
OK. Here I go!

) At the beginning of Rydia's chapter, we see Rydia and Edward talking about how Cecil and Rosa, and Yang are helping to rebuild Mist. This is seventeen years before The After Years. A scene is showed, where Edge is stopped from leaving the castle, by Seneschal. He says that Eblan's treasures are being sold for profit, and Edge says, wouldn't that be good? Seneschal says he only hopes that is the case, meaning that Edge was lying, and that money actually went for rebuilding Mist. For Rydia! Aww..

2)At the end of Edge's chapter, he, Tsukinowa, Gekkou, Izayoi and Zangetsu, are weakened by the attack from the Mysterious Girl. They flee, and Edge gets a flashback of Rydia ticking him off about stealing an enemy's ship in ff4. He decides to jump off that area to below based on a complete gamble of his life, as they are cornered by the Mysterious Girl. The other ninja's thinking he has a proper plan, follow suit. Coincidentally, Luca's ship, with Rydia on it, were passing through. Edge and the ninja's fell on the ship. Rydia, bewildered, asks him, what, why and how did he fall from the sky, and he says mildly.
"Rydia? Is this heaven?" LOL.

3)In the Crystal's chapter I think, Rydia, Edge, and the others go to Mist. There, the voice of Rydia's mother speaks to her. After the voice finishes speaking to her, Rydia bows down her head. Edge is concerned for her and says : "Rydia . . ." to which Rydia says, "I swear to it, Mother!"

4)In a more previous scene, they see antlions surrounded in a castle (can't remember which, if I'm not wrong, in Damycan Castle) and before Edge attacked them, or something like that, Rydia told him not to hurt them please. And he withdrew because of her, saying "Rydia . . ."

5)When Rydia, Edge, Luca and the Man in Black were at Eblan, they find out Ifrit has been causing the damage. Edge tells them all to leave the guy to him, and Rydia retorts that is suicide! Edge replies that there is no time to lose and tells them to flee. Rydia calls him and tries to stop him, but he runs off. He fights Ifrit but is wounded. As he lays wounded, he says to himself, "So..this is the end. Rydia..did you make it out?"
Then Rubicante appears, and Edge fights him. Rydia all of a sudden appears too, and says, "Edge! You expected me to listen?" and Edge comments jokingly,"Heh.It's your funeral."
Then they learn Ifrit is weak against fire, and Rydia says, "So..fire against fire?" and Edge replies, "You got it!" They learn their band technique "Inferno".
They win against Ifrit, recruiting him, and Rydia scolds him saying, "Have you gone mad?! Challenging an Eidolon by yourself?" and he replies, "Not by myself."

6)After Rydia, Edge, Luca and the Man in Black manage to find Ursula and Yang, where Edge bangs Yang on the head with Sheila's frying pan, and Rydia on Ursula's head with Sheila's ladle, they wake up. The Sylps lend them their powers, and Rydia comments sadly, "So this malaise has reached the Eidolon King himself . . ." and she bows her head. Luca says, "Rydia ..." and Edge comforts her, saying, "Come on, Rydia. Those Eidolons mean much more to you that all that, don't they?"
She answers, "..You're right. They do." Rydia is OK after his comfort only.

7)Oh yeah, we learn in one part in ff4 The After Years after we talk to a person in Mist, that Edge (by the guy's description, we know for sure it's Edge) has often visited Mist to see Rydia, but I think he was hiding from Rydia and spying on her. LOL. Edge, Edge. (Shakes head)

8)They have a band technique together called Broken Heart. Though I'm not sure what this means exactly.

9)Edge leaves Eblan Castle for Mist. He dismisses the Eblan Four, but they swear to await further orders. In Mist, Rydia is currently raising a small girl named Cuore (who appears to be a child version of Maenad). Both Leviathan and Ashura arrive, greeting Rydia and saying that they figured that since Rydia wasn't able to make it into the Feymarch last time she tried, it was their turn to pay her a visit.(from ff wiki).
Edge sees Rydia, and promptly tries to run away, not wishing Rydia to see him, but Cuore spots him, and drags him over.
Asura reveals that it was Edge who invited them. Rydia is shocked, but says, in her heart, "thank you ... Edge!" It seemed that Rydia sorta finally accepted him(but not directly/straightforward).
